Friday, May 13

i feel so fcuked up.
all u ever feel is anger and frustration.
how true.
and all i ever did is to make u angry and frustrated.
i am such a failure.

why am i living in my own world..
get me out of this fcuked up lala land of mine.

Posted by jiawen at 16:58